The Butterfly Effect
The Butterfly Effect is a concept that suggests that a small change or action can have much larger and far-reaching effects over time. This idea originates from chaos theory and is often illustrated by the metaphorical example of a butterfly flapping its wings in one part of the world leading to a hurricane in another part.
